Optimal partitions, regularized solutions, and application to image classification

&
Pages 15-35 | Received 03 May 2004, Published online: 15 Aug 2006
 

Abstract

This article is concerned with the problem of finding a regular and homogeneous partition of a Lipschitz open set Ω of

. This type of problem occurs in image classification which consists in assigning a label (that is a class or a phase) to each pixel of an observed image. Such a problem can numerically be solved by using a level set formulation. But this approach generally relies on heuristic arguments. We intend here to give a theoretical justification in the two phases case. In the first part of the paper, we prove that the partition problem we consider admits a solution. And in the second part, we justify the numerical approach which is generally used to compute a solution.
